S04 – Book Club #4 – Maxine Beneba Clarke
44:57 | July 17th, 2022

Join Melbourne-based writer, artist and poet Maxine Beneba Clarke, whose award-winning books include Wide Big World, The Patchwork Bike and Fashionista – a celebration of self-expression. Maxine is an Australian writer of Afro-Caribbean heritage whose stories embrace individuality and celebrate differences and diversity by using the natural wonders of the world.

S04 – Book Club #3 – Li Cunxin
52:01 | July 10th, 2022

Hear from Li Cunxin AO, author of Mao’s Last Dancer and Artistic Director of the QLD Ballet. His memoir tells the story of adapting to change and overcoming adversity.

S04 – Book Club #2 – Zana Fraillion
54:13 | July 3rd, 2022

Join multi-award winning, Melbourne based author Zana Fraillon as she shares her inspiration for writing, her research process and how she honours real life human stories when creating fiction. Her new book The Curiosities is inspired by people who see the world differently – and make it more wondrous. With themes of creativity, curiosity and neurodivergence, this is an essential conversation.
